BONES performing RIP motion at the Biomechatronics Laboratory - University of California Irvine

BONES is a neurorehabilitation exoskeleton for stroke patients. In this video, BONES is tested assisting an unimpaired subject in performing the Reflex Inhibiting Pattern (RIP). For more informatio...
